Description

This form is By-Laws for a Business Corporation and contains provisons regarding how the corporation will be operated, as well as provisions governing shareholders meetings, officers, directors, voting of shares, stock records and more. Approximately 9 pages.

Bylaws for a corporation are the rules and regulations that govern the management and operation of the business. They outline the responsibilities of directors and officers, meeting procedures, and shareholder rights. Understanding these bylaws is crucial, as they establish the framework for corporate governance and ensure compliance with Missouri state laws.
